A powerful and beautiful sculpture-like piece about the healing time we spend at the sea. The painting is part of a series done after a poem of Erich Fried called "Wenn Du zum Meer gehst...", one of my favourite poems.

The expressive painting shows lots of marks and traces of the painting process. It can be turned and hanged in any direction you like and it still works.

Acrylics on 40x80x7 cm gallery wrapped deep canvas, unframed, sides painted and part of the artwork, no framing needed, painting can hang with just two nails/screws. Signed on the back.

Of course framing is still possible, if wanted, any good framer can advise you on that or contact me.

Based in Germany, Gesa Reuter’s artistic practice started in 1996. She has since studied the techniques of the old Dutch masters, layering selfmade gouache, egg tempera and sometimes oil to build her paintings with different layers of paint from thin to thick. Recently she has discovered the power of watercolours and ink in her work, enjoying the way the watery materials leave marks and traces to describe her inner feelings and emotions. Rather than painting an accurate visual representation of a landscape, she prefers to use the power of memory; her artworks are an expression of her feelings and emotions in the moment of experiencing the landscape." (Inside Artists, Issue 9, Summer 2017) So far, her works have been exhibited in Germany and Europe, mainly sold to private collectors in Germany, U.S.A., UK, NL, New Zealand, Saudi Arabia, to architects, small companies, private medical and psychological practices. In public collection of Amateras Foundation, Bulgaria, NHS England and Kunsthaus Stove, Germany.
